How to Find Coworking Spaces While Traveling

Ahmad Tolga by Ahmad Tolga
August 5, 2025
in TRAVEL
5 min read
0
Find Coworking Spaces in Traveling

The freedom to work from anywhere is one of the biggest perks of being a digital nomad or remote worker. But as exciting as it is to hop from one destination to the next, finding a productive and reliable workspace while traveling can sometimes be a challenge. Hotel rooms and noisy cafés don’t always cut it when you need to focus, take calls, or power through deadlines.

That’s where coworking spaces come in. They offer a professional environment, fast Wi-Fi, comfortable seating, and the opportunity to network with like-minded individuals. Whether you’re on a short business trip or full-time remote work journey, knowing how to find coworking spaces while traveling can make your life a lot easier and a lot more productive.

Here’s a practical guide to help you find your next work-friendly spot no matter where you go.

Why Coworking Spaces Matter When Traveling

When you’re working remotely on the road, your workspace can have a huge impact on your performance, focus, and mental well-being. Coworking spaces solve several problems that remote professionals commonly face while abroad.

Here’s why they’re worth seeking out:

  • Reliable Wi-Fi: No more hunting for cafés with decent internet. Coworking spaces are designed for bandwidth-heavy tasks like video calls and large uploads.

  • Professional Environment: Whether you’re doing deep work or taking Zoom meetings, a proper desk and quiet space go a long way.

  • Community and Networking: These spaces often attract local entrepreneurs and fellow travelers, creating natural opportunities for collaboration and social interaction.

  • Convenient Amenities: Think meeting rooms, printers, phone booths, coffee bars, and ergonomic chairs features you won’t find in a coffee shop.

For those practicing remote work while traveling, a good coworking setup often becomes the foundation of their daily routine.

Use Coworking Search Platforms and Apps

Thanks to the rise of remote work, several websites and apps now specialize in helping travelers discover coworking spaces around the world. These tools make it simple to browse, compare, and even book your workspace in advance.

Here are some top platforms:

  • Coworker.com: The most comprehensive coworking directory, covering over 25,000 spaces in 170+ countries. Offers reviews, ratings, and booking options.

  • Workfrom: A community-driven app that lists both coworking spaces and laptop-friendly cafés, complete with Wi-Fi speed ratings and ambiance descriptions.

  • Croissant: Offers access to multiple coworking spaces in select cities with a flexible pass system. Ideal for short stays and variety seekers.

  • Deskpass: Similar to Croissant, it provides a membership model that grants access to a network of coworking spaces. Available in many major U.S. cities and some international ones.

  • WeWork: Known for global consistency, WeWork offers day passes and monthly memberships. A good choice if you want familiar quality in big cities abroad.

Use filters to narrow your options by Wi-Fi quality, open hours, amenities, and proximity. These coworking space apps are essential for digital nomads planning ahead.

Check Travel Communities and Forums

Sometimes the best recommendations come from fellow travelers. Online communities are filled with first-hand experiences and up-to-date advice.

Places to find tips:

  • Reddit (e.g., r/digitalnomad or r/solotravel)

  • Facebook Groups (such as “Digital Nomads Around the World” or “Remote Work & Travel”)

  • Nomad List: A platform where users rank cities based on digital nomad-friendliness. Often includes coworking reviews.

  • Slack communities: Many remote work Slack groups have location-specific channels with coworking suggestions.

Ask questions like, “What’s the best coworking space in Medellín?” or “Where can I work in Lisbon for a day with good Wi-Fi?” You’ll be surprised by how helpful these networks can be.

Look on Google Maps and Read Reviews

A quick Google search like “coworking space near me” or “coworking in [city]” can uncover hidden gems. Google Maps is a great starting point when you’re already on location.

What to look for:

  • High star ratings (above 4.0)

  • Consistent positive feedback about Wi-Fi, atmosphere, and cleanliness

  • Recent reviews especially those within the last 3–6 months

  • Photos of the interior and desk setup

This method is particularly useful when you’re in smaller cities where global platforms may not list every available space.

Book in Advance (or Try a Free Day Pass)

Many coworking spaces offer day passes, free trial days, or discounted first-time rates. Take advantage of these options to test the vibe before committing to a longer pass.

If you’re traveling during peak seasons or in popular digital nomad hubs like Bali, Chiang Mai, or Lisbon, it’s a good idea to reserve a desk in advance especially if you plan to work full-time during your trip.

Booking ahead also allows you to:

  • Plan your commute

  • Schedule meetings

  • Ensure you have access to key amenities (e.g., private rooms or quiet zones)

Evaluate Based on Your Needs

Not all coworking spaces are created equal. Choosing the right one depends on your personal work style and needs.

Questions to ask yourself:

  • Is fast, stable Wi-Fi a must?

  • Do you need silence or background noise to focus?

  • Are phone booths or private rooms important for meetings?

  • Do you prefer a social atmosphere or a quiet one?

  • Is proximity to your accommodation important?

Look for spaces with flexible options. For example, some places offer hot desks (shared seating), while others offer dedicated desks or even private offices for a premium.

Ask Locals or Hotel/Hostel Staff

Never underestimate local knowledge. Staff at hostels, hotels, or guesthouses often know where remote workers hang out. They might even partner with nearby coworking spaces to offer discounts to guests.

Additionally, many cities have “unofficial” coworking cafés independent coffee shops known for being work-friendly, with plenty of outlets and a chill vibe. These may not show up on formal coworking directories but can be perfect for casual work sessions.
